How to Predict Property Price Growth Using Infrastructure Data

The Smart Investor’s Guide to Finding Tomorrow’s High-Growth Communities

Real estate is more than location—it’s about understanding what a location is becoming.

Across the UAE, major infrastructure developments such as new metro lines, highways, airports, waterfront destinations, business districts, and lifestyle projects have consistently supported long-term property value appreciation. Investors who identify these developments early often position themselves to benefit from future demand.

Rather than relying on assumptions, successful investors combine infrastructure insights with market data to make informed investment decisions.

This guide explains how infrastructure influences property price growth and the indicators every investor should monitor before making their next purchase.

Why Infrastructure Matters in Real Estate

Infrastructure creates accessibility, convenience, employment opportunities, and improved lifestyles.

As connectivity and amenities improve, communities become more attractive to:

  • Homebuyers
  • Long-term residents
  • Professionals
  • Businesses
  • International investors

This growing demand often contributes to stronger property values over time.

Infrastructure improvements include:

  • Metro expansions
  • New highways and road networks
  • Airports and transport hubs
  • Schools and universities
  • Hospitals and healthcare facilities
  • Shopping malls
  • Parks and waterfront developments
  • Business districts
  • Entertainment destinations

How Infrastructure Supports Property Price Growth

Instead of focusing only on today’s prices, experienced investors look at future developments.

1. Transportation Connectivity

Properties located near transport hubs generally attract greater buyer and tenant interest.

Examples include:

  • Metro stations
  • Major highways
  • Bus networks
  • Future transport corridors

Improved accessibility increases convenience, making communities more desirable.

2. Commercial Development

Business activity creates housing demand.

Watch for:

  • Office districts
  • Business parks
  • Free zones
  • Corporate headquarters
  • Mixed-use developments

Growing employment opportunities often encourage residential demand nearby.

3. Lifestyle Infrastructure

Modern buyers value convenience.

Communities offering lifestyle amenities typically experience healthy demand.

Examples include:

  • Retail destinations
  • Restaurants
  • Waterfront promenades
  • Parks
  • Fitness facilities
  • Family attractions

These features contribute to a more attractive living environment.

4. Education and Healthcare

Families often prioritize access to quality services.

Key developments include:

  • International schools
  • Universities
  • Medical centers
  • Specialty hospitals

Communities with strong educational and healthcare infrastructure continue attracting long-term residents.

5. Government Master Plans

Government-led development strategies often shape future growth.

Examples include:

  • Urban expansion
  • Smart city initiatives
  • Sustainability projects
  • Public transportation investments
  • Economic development zones

These initiatives can support demand across multiple property sectors.

UAE Infrastructure Projects Supporting Long-Term Growth

Dubai Metro Blue Line

The planned metro expansion is expected to improve connectivity across several communities, enhancing accessibility for residents and businesses.

Dubai 2040 Urban Master Plan

The strategy focuses on:

  • Sustainable urban growth
  • Increased green spaces
  • Enhanced mobility
  • Improved public facilities
  • Better quality of life

These initiatives are designed to support long-term residential and commercial development.

Dubai South

Dubai South continues expanding with:

  • Residential communities
  • Logistics facilities
  • Commercial districts
  • Aviation-related businesses

Its proximity to Al Maktoum International Airport positions it as one of Dubai’s key growth corridors.

Expo City Dubai

Expo City continues evolving into an innovation-focused destination featuring:

  • Business hubs
  • Residential developments
  • Educational institutions
  • Technology companies
  • Sustainable urban planning

Approximate Property Growth Trends Around Major Infrastructure

While every community performs differently, areas benefiting from significant infrastructure improvements have historically experienced healthy long-term appreciation.

Illustrative examples:

Infrastructure Improvement Possible Market Impact
New Metro Station Improved accessibility and stronger buyer interest
Major Highway Connection Easier commuting and wider market appeal
Business District Expansion Increased housing demand from professionals
New Schools & Hospitals Higher appeal for families
Waterfront Development Lifestyle enhancement and premium positioning
Retail & Entertainment Projects Increased community attractiveness

Actual performance varies depending on market conditions, demand, supply, and broader economic factors.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Why is infrastructure important when investing in property?

Infrastructure improves accessibility, lifestyle, and convenience, making communities more attractive to residents, businesses, and investors. These factors often support long-term property value growth.

2. Which infrastructure projects have the biggest influence on property prices?

Major transport projects, business districts, schools, healthcare facilities, parks, waterfront developments, and large mixed-use communities are among the strongest contributors to long-term demand.

3. How can I identify communities with strong growth potential?

Look for areas with upcoming infrastructure projects, increasing transaction activity, expanding amenities, improving connectivity, and growing residential and commercial development.

4. Can infrastructure data help first-time property investors?

Yes. Infrastructure insights provide valuable context about future community development, helping investors evaluate opportunities with greater confidence alongside other market indicators.
